Albany Airport To Receive $1.1 Million For Security Upgrades

Albany International Airport
wikipedia.org

Capital Region Congressman Paul Tonko announced Wednesday that Albany International Airport will receive $1.1 million from the Federal Aviation Administration for security enhancements.

In a statement, Tonko said the grant will ensure the airport “will have the resources it needs to maintain a safe and professional atmosphere, continuing to meet the demands of our business and leisure travelers, and develop the local economy here in the Capital Region.”

More than 2 million passengers use the airport annually.
